The System Is Not Broken; It Is Out of Balance

The accounts receivable management industry is under siege by state and federal lawmakers, state and federal regulatory bodies and the press. The current political climate favors consumer protection at all levels of government.

In just the first 13 days of 2011, legislation to curtail or restrict some form of debt collection activity was introduced in Connecticut, Indiana, Iowa, Mississippi, Montana, New York, North Dakota, Oklahoma, Virginia, and Wyoming and this is just the beginning of the legislative session for most states.
